Solution Architect (Bloomreach SME)

Contract Length: Initial 6-month contract

Location: Home-based with occasional UK travel (approximately once per month) for workshops, stakeholder meetings and client engagements

Security Clearance: BPSS required. SC eligibility desirable.

Rate: £580 per day inside IR35

Overview

We are seeking an experienced Bloomreach Consultant to support a significant website consolidation programme for a large UK healthcare organisation.

The successful candidate will bring proven expertise in implementing and configuring Bloomreach as a Headless CMS, enabling content delivery via APIs across multiple digital channels and user interfaces. This role will play a key part in consolidating multiple websites into a unified digital estate while establishing scalable content models, governance standards and publishing processes.

This is an excellent opportunity to work on a high-profile digital transformation programme within a complex and regulated environment.

Key Responsibilities

Configure, implement and optimise Bloomreach CMS as a headless content management platform.

Support the migration and consolidation of multiple websites and content repositories into a single digital ecosystem.

Design and implement content models, taxonomies, metadata structures and information architectures.

Establish and support content governance frameworks, publishing workflows and approval processes.

Provide expertise in API-driven content delivery, integration patterns and headless architecture best practices.

Work closely with architects, developers, content teams, product owners and business stakeholders to ensure successful delivery.

Support agile ways of working through backlog refinement, sprint planning, workshops and stakeholder engagement activities.

Identify opportunities to improve content management efficiency, scalability and user experience across the organisation's digital estate.Essential Experience

Proven hands-on experience delivering solutions using Bloomreach CMS.

Demonstrable experience implementing and managing Headless CMS architectures.

Strong understanding of API-based content delivery and integration approaches.

Experience migrating content from multiple websites, digital estates or legacy CMS platforms.

Solid knowledge of content governance, publishing workflows and content lifecycle management.

Experience operating within agile, multidisciplinary delivery teams.

Strong stakeholder management skills with the ability to communicate effectively with both technical and non-technical audiences.

Experience supporting large-scale website transformation or consolidation initiatives.Desirable Experience

Experience working within healthcare, public sector or other highly regulated environments.

Knowledge of content migration tools and methodologies.
